International payments fintech is responding to the cost-of-living crisis by introducing a new lightweight suite of point-of-sale (POS) options, which it states will create “an entry-level POS item” for the smallest independent services.
The brand-new solution, called POS Lite, includes a 13in splash-proof touchscreen and stand, card reader, and subscription to SumUp’s software. Created for nano-sized and small businesses, it will allow merchants to register card and money payments, organise their item brochure, track revenues and more. It is based upon the fintech’s existing POS Pro system however designed to be more cost efficient; in current months, small businesses have actually been hit the hardest by rising fuel expenses, spiralling inflation and higher service rates.

A POS system (point of sale system) is the hardware utilized to process payments and orders, in addition to the software running on those systems. ‘Point of sale’ describes the time and place a consumer connects with a merchant to buy items or services.
Processing payments, POS systems– such as Point of Sale Lite– normally enable the merchant to take care of administrative tasks, like analysing deal reports and handling their products and costs from one single platform.

Do I need a card reader to accept card payments with Point of Sale Lite?
Yes, you do require a SumUp card reader to accept card payments together with Point of Sale Lite.
Currently, Point of Sale Lite works with the SumUp Air card reader. You can get it here if you do not have an Air card reader yet. You can acquire the standalone Point of Sale Lite tablet here if you already have an Air card reader.
Can I connect Point of Sale Lite to my existing profile?
Yes, if you already have a profile, simply log in with your qualifications when turning on your POS Lite.
As soon as visited, you have immediate access to your profile, your individual item catalogue, your sales history and the Business Account.
Point of Sale Lite works with invoice printers from Star Micronics and Epson that are able to communicate over USB, Bluetooth or Wi-Fi. Please keep in mind that the Solo Printer can currently not be used with Point of Sale Lite.

Checkout alternatives: This is part of the Core POS module. The checkout screen in the app reveals the product design, categories (in separate tabs) and a left-hand view of the existing, itemised costs. You’ll need to modify the item screen in the back office– this can not be carried out in the app.
It provides you an option to accept payment over the phone, however you’ll require to handle this through your selected payment processors because the till app only provides you the choice to register it as ‘Phone’. The exact same applies to tapping ‘Other’, ‘Gift Card/ Voucher’, ‘Account’ on the payment screen– there is no screen for entering a referral number, so you’ll require to have a system for tracking these yourself.
With an integrated card maker, the POS app will work in combination with it for a smooth checkout. If incorporated with payments, the POS app connects with the Air card reader and permits you to send out payment links or create a QR code for the deal directly on the screen.
Invoices: The till app lets you send an e-mail invoice after each sale or print a sales receipt through a linked printer. We have actually seen reports from users that the app instantly prints an invoice each time, even when you tap that it’s not needed, so you can’t actually minimize invoice paper until this bug is repaired.
Stock library: With the Core POS module, you have fundamental item management capabilities. This includes stock levels, low stock notifications, provider lists, bulk item import and a comprehensive products library.
Each product can be connected to a classification and have variants, characteristics (included layer of variations), modifiers, tags, SKUs, VAT rates, an image and more. After items are added to your account, you can include them to the till user interface through the a little clumsy ‘Selling Design’ in the back workplace.
